About The Role

The Health Care Aide (HCA) reports to the Director of Care and/or designate and provides person served holistic and quality care. The HCA at our communities is an integral member of the team, performing their role in accordance with established policies and procedures, while maintaining the rights of residents and ensuring they are treated with respect and dignity.

Responsibilities

Include but not limited to:

  • Be an engaged collaborative team player, developing and maintaining professional relationships that support and strengthen the organizational culture and purpose.
  • Follows established care plans.
  • Provides personal care for our residents from admission or transfer including; bathing, grooming, dressing, assists with meals, oral hygiene and performing other care duties as applicable.
  • Responds to call bells/alarms.
  • Observes and monitors residents progress, symptoms and behavioral changes and reports significant observations.
  • Utilizes proper safety protocols when operating mechanical aides such as specialty beds, wheelchairs, and stretchers to transport residents.
  • Aids with lifting and/or transferring of residents by following established lifting/safety techniques.
  • Provides residents with nutritional assistance (e.g. meals, nourishment and tray service, assists residents to eat as needed). Assists residents to and from dining areas in accordance with meal service schedules. Reports any appetite/fluid/food intake changes or concerns immediately to the nurse.
  • Encourages resident participation in food service and clean up.
  • Performs laundry of resident’s personal clothing as required.
  • Involves the resident in organizing and maintaining their home environment, ensuring it is done according to the residents’ wishes and needs.
  • Attends and participates in community and education programs.
  • Performs other related duties as required.

Qualifications And Skills

  • Graduate from a recognized Care Aide Program.
  • An active registration with the British Columbia Care Aide & Community Health Worker Registry.
  • Food Safe Level 1 Certificate an asset.
  • Medication Administration Certification an asset.
  • Previous experience in a long term care facility an asset.
  • Demonstrates ability to provide compassionate and empathetic care.
  • Ability to read, write and speak English proficiently and understand verbal and written instructions.
  • All successful applicants must pass the vulnerable sector Criminal Record Check applicable to Provincial guidelines.
  • Ability to push, pull, stoop, crouch, lift and carry up to 25 lbs. Must be able to work with cleaners, detergents and other cleaning equipment.
